Web7 Feb 2024 · Temporary paralysis (also known as periodic paralysis) occurs when all or some muscle control in any part of the body comes and goes periodically (i.e. from time to time). This episodic paralysis most often occurs because of muscle weakness, diseases, or hereditary causes. Web18 Jan 2024 · Injuries that cause temporary disabilities generally are not related to the insured’s age, health, job, or other risk factors. They just happen, like a bad fall or a car accident that causes a broken bone. Still, you may be asked about pre-existing health conditions that may either disqualify you from coverage or limit your benefits.
